    Administrative history

    The Calliopean Association, Fraternitas, Polyhymnia and Philo-Rhetorician were literary societies of male students at Victoria College in Cobourg that were founded to provide practice in extemporaneous speaking. The Calliopean Association was organized in 1844 and continued to 1847. In 1847, Fraternitas was formed and existed until 1849. Fraternitas produced a paper called the Angler (their predecessors produced the Literary Gem). From 1849 until the spring of 1850, the Polyhymnia was organized and finally the Philo-Rhetorician from 1850 until 1852.

    Scope and content

    Consists of a small number of constitutions, by-laws and minutes from the following societies: Calliopean Association, 1846; Fraternitas, 1847-1849; Polyhymnia, 1849-1850; and Philo-Rhetorician, 1850-1852. File level description has not been completed.
